Marcelo out of first leg against Roma
Full-back suffering from shoulder problem
Posted Wednesday, February 10, 2016 by Marca.com
There is yet more bad news for Zinedine Zidane. Gareth Bale, who is almost certainly ruled out of the first leg of the Champions League last-16 tie against Roma on 17th February, will be joined on the sidelines by Marcelo, who underwent medical examinations on Tuesday at the Hospital Universitario Sanitas La Moraleja. The Brazilian has dislocated his right shoulder which will force him to sit out the first leg in the Italian capital.
